Silver colour coded SC - a- like, Fosse Park, Leicester

I saw this car for the first time at the CLA Game Fair back in July.

It's a silver TDV6, fully colour coded and made to look like a SC except no pretend exhaust tips.

When I say colour coded, I mean all the black plastic and EVEN the mudlfaps have been done. I looked closely at the workmanship and I'd say the black plastic does not take the paint well, it looked very patchy and grainy. Bound to peel sooner or later.
